3. Strategic Rebrand to heyAura (2 April 2026)

Overview: The company formerly known as AdEx, a decentralized advertising protocol, officially rebranded to heyAura. This marked a complete strategic pivot from advertising infrastructure to building autonomous AI assistants that live inside Web3 wallets. The AI aims to help users execute complex on-chain actions via natural language, with a focus on privacy and human oversight.

What this means: This is a foundational, bullish shift that aligns the project with the high-growth AI and wallet narrative. Moving away from the competitive advertising niche to solve for on-chain complexity could open a larger market. However, success now hinges on execution, user adoption, and proving the AI's tangible value, making this a high-potential but execution-dependent transition. (CryptoBriefing)

1. Staking UI Overhaul (July 2026)

Overview: This update revamps the user interface for staking ADX tokens, making it easier to manage stakes and rewards. It's part of a broader upgrade to the staking mechanism that gives users more flexibility.

The primary repository, adex-staking, saw significant commit activity in July 2026. This work implements a new staking system that consolidates all rewards into a single pool and allows stakers full control over their lockup periods. The upgrade is designed to make $ADX easier to integrate into the broader AURA ecosystem, paving the way for future features.

What this means: This is bullish for $ADX because it creates a more user-friendly and flexible staking experience, which could encourage more users to lock up their tokens. A stronger staking system can help secure the network and reduce sell pressure. (Source)

3. AURA Demo & Ecosystem Launch (August 2025)

Overview: This milestone update marked the first public release of the AURA AI agent demo, allowing users to test personalized portfolio strategies. It included major backend improvements and new partnerships.

Key improvements listed in the August 2025 development update include the integration of automated testing for the AI language models, upgraded prompt engineering for better responses, and added support for BNB Smart Chain and Mantle networks. A pivotal integration with CoinGecko's Model Context Protocol (MCP) provided the AI with real-time, on-chain market data for millions of tokens.

What this means: This was a major bullish step for heyAura as it transitioned from concept to a live, testable product. Expanding to new blockchains and integrating reliable data sources makes the agent more useful to a wider audience, directly supporting adoption. (Source)

3. Launch of Revamped Staking with $stkADX (2026)

Overview: To align tokenomics with the new heyAura ecosystem, the team is launching a singular, streamlined staking pool featuring a new token, $stkADX (heyAura). It maintains a 1:1 value with ADX but automatically accrues rewards. Mechanics include variable lock times for boosted yields and gasless interactions via ERC-2612 permits.

What this means: This is bullish for ADX as it modernizes the staking model, potentially increasing token lock-up and reducing sell pressure. A well-designed mechanism could strengthen the token's role in curating DeFi lists within the heyAura platform.
